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Erreur de periphérique, scanner

9 réponses
Avatar
ROBERT LEFEVRE
Bonjour,
J'essaie d'installer un scanner scsi canon (canoscan 300) sue mon linux
(Debian Etch).
1) La commande "sane-find-scanner" me le trouve bien :
found SCSI scanner "CANON IX-03035B 1.02" at /dev/sg5
# Your SCSI scanner was detected. It may or may not be supported by
SANE. Try
# scanimage -L and read the backend's manpage.
2) Par contre, la commande "scanimage -L" me renvoie:

device `v4l:/dev/video0' is a Noname BT878 video (Pinnacle PCTV Stud
virtual device
3) Si je lance xsane, je me retrouve bien à scanner avec... ma carte
Pinnacle studio TV.
Je sais qu'on peut écrire des règles udev, pour qu'à un périphérique
donné ne soit pas attribué un fichier /dev/sg* qui correspond à un
autre, mais je ne sais pas comment faire. J'ai été regarder dans
/etc/udev et j'ai peur de casser quelque chose.
Un coup de main svp, merci!

9 réponses

Avatar
Vincent Felsch
"ROBERT LEFEVRE" a écrit dans le message de news:
47a4281e$0$869$
Bonjour,
J'essaie d'installer un scanner scsi canon (canoscan 300) sue mon linux
(Debian Etch).
1) La commande "sane-find-scanner" me le trouve bien :
found SCSI scanner "CANON IX-03035B 1.02" at /dev/sg5
# Your SCSI scanner was detected. It may or may not be supported by
SANE. Try
# scanimage -L and read the backend's manpage.
2) Par contre, la commande "scanimage -L" me renvoie:

device `v4l:/dev/video0' is a Noname BT878 video (Pinnacle PCTV Stud
virtual device
3) Si je lance xsane, je me retrouve bien à scanner avec... ma carte
Pinnacle studio TV.
Je sais qu'on peut écrire des règles udev, pour qu'à un périphérique
donné ne soit pas attribué un fichier /dev/sg* qui correspond à un autre,
mais je ne sais pas comment faire. J'ai été regarder dans /etc/udev et
j'ai peur de casser quelque chose.
Un coup de main svp, merci!


Bonjour
ça fait longtemps que j'ai plus installé de scanner sous linux mais si j'ai
bonne mémoire il faut récupérer le fichier *.bin des pilotes Windows pour
que le scanner fonctionne.

Cordialement

Vincent F.

Avatar
Luc.Habert.00__arjf
ROBERT LEFEVRE :

J'essaie d'installer un scanner scsi canon (canoscan 300) sue mon linux
(Debian Etch).
1) La commande "sane-find-scanner" me le trouve bien :
found SCSI scanner "CANON IX-03035B 1.02" at /dev/sg5
# Your SCSI scanner was detected. It may or may not be supported by
SANE. Try
# scanimage -L and read the backend's manpage.
2) Par contre, la commande "scanimage -L" me renvoie:

device `v4l:/dev/video0' is a Noname BT878 video (Pinnacle PCTV Stud
virtual device


As-tu bien les droits de lecture et écriture sur /dev/sg5?
Est-ce que « scanimage -d canon:/dev/sg5 » fonctionne?

Avatar
ROBERT LEFEVRE
ROBERT LEFEVRE :

J'essaie d'installer un scanner scsi canon (canoscan 300) sue mon linux
(Debian Etch).
1) La commande "sane-find-scanner" me le trouve bien :
found SCSI scanner "CANON IX-03035B 1.02" at /dev/sg5
# Your SCSI scanner was detected. It may or may not be supported by
SANE. Try
# scanimage -L and read the backend's manpage.
2) Par contre, la commande "scanimage -L" me renvoie:

device `v4l:/dev/video0' is a Noname BT878 video (Pinnacle PCTV Stud
virtual device


As-tu bien les droits de lecture et écriture sur /dev/sg5?
Est-ce que « scanimage -d canon:/dev/sg5 » fonctionne?
Bonjour et merci pour ta réponse. Oui, cette commande fonctionne

parfaitement "scanimage -d canon:/dev/sg5 > test.pnm" m'a fait un beau
fichier image. Mon problème, c'est que xscanimage et xsane ne "voient"
que le périphérique "video0", c'est à dire ma carte TV. Il y a un truc
qui m'échappe encore...
A+


Avatar
Luc.Habert.00__arjf
ROBERT LEFEVRE :

Bonjour et merci pour ta réponse. Oui, cette commande fonctionne
parfaitement "scanimage -d canon:/dev/sg5 > test.pnm" m'a fait un beau
fichier image. Mon problème, c'est que xscanimage et xsane ne "voient"
que le périphérique "video0", c'est à dire ma carte TV. Il y a un truc
qui m'échappe encore...


Tu peux mettre SANE_DEFAULT_DEVICEÊnon:/dev/sg5 dans l'environnement.

Avatar
ROBERT LEFEVRE
ROBERT LEFEVRE :

Bonjour et merci pour ta réponse. Oui, cette commande fonctionne
parfaitement "scanimage -d canon:/dev/sg5 > test.pnm" m'a fait un beau
fichier image. Mon problème, c'est que xscanimage et xsane ne "voient"
que le périphérique "video0", c'est à dire ma carte TV. Il y a un truc
qui m'échappe encore...


Tu peux mettre SANE_DEFAULT_DEVICEÊnon:/dev/sg5 dans l'environnement.


Je l'ai déjà fait (page de man de sane) mais le problème vient

d'ailleurs je pense. Au redémarrage, mon scanner est maintenant sur
/dev/sg4 et bien sûr il ne fonctionne pas. C'est pourquoi je pense à
écrire une règle udev. J'ai eu ce type de problème de périphérique avec
mes disques durs qui changeaient de fichier dev, je m'en suis sorti en
faisant des LABEL sur mes disques, mais pour le scanner je sèche encore.
Merci quand même, j'avance.


Avatar
Marc Dejardin
Bonjour,
J'essaie d'installer un scanner scsi canon (canoscan 300) sue mon linux
(Debian Etch).
1) La commande "sane-find-scanner" me le trouve bien :
found SCSI scanner "CANON IX-03035B 1.02" at /dev/sg5
# Your SCSI scanner was detected. It may or may not be supported by
SANE. Try
# scanimage -L and read the backend's manpage.
2) Par contre, la commande "scanimage -L" me renvoie:

device `v4l:/dev/video0' is a Noname BT878 video (Pinnacle PCTV Stud
virtual device
3) Si je lance xsane, je me retrouve bien à scanner avec... ma carte
Pinnacle studio TV.
Je sais qu'on peut écrire des règles udev, pour qu'à un périphérique
donné ne soit pas attribué un fichier /dev/sg* qui correspond à un
autre, mais je ne sais pas comment faire. J'ai été regarder dans
/etc/udev et j'ai peur de casser quelque chose.
Un coup de main svp, merci!


Bonjour,
Je vais peut-être persévérer dans l'erreur, mais je viens de faire une
réponse dans le fil SOS du 01/02.
Cette réponse est peut-être valide pour ce problème là aussi.

Sans garantie.

Cordialement
M.D.

Avatar
JKB
Le 04-02-2008, à propos de
Re: Erreur de periphérique, scanner,
ROBERT LEFEVRE écrivait dans fr.comp.os.linux.configuration :
ROBERT LEFEVRE :

Bonjour et merci pour ta réponse. Oui, cette commande fonctionne
parfaitement "scanimage -d canon:/dev/sg5 > test.pnm" m'a fait un beau
fichier image. Mon problème, c'est que xscanimage et xsane ne "voient"
que le périphérique "video0", c'est à dire ma carte TV. Il y a un truc
qui m'échappe encore...


Tu peux mettre SANE_DEFAULT_DEVICEÊnon:/dev/sg5 dans l'environnement.


Je l'ai déjà fait (page de man de sane) mais le problème vient

d'ailleurs je pense. Au redémarrage, mon scanner est maintenant sur
/dev/sg4 et bien sûr il ne fonctionne pas. C'est pourquoi je pense à
écrire une règle udev. J'ai eu ce type de problème de périphérique avec
mes disques durs qui changeaient de fichier dev, je m'en suis sorti en
faisant des LABEL sur mes disques, mais pour le scanner je sèche encore.
Merci quand même, j'avance.


Je n'ai pas tout suivi, mais si ma mémoire est bonne, il s'agit d'un
scanner PSC. Le daemon hpoj est-il fonctionnel ? Que donne un
ps auwx | grep ptal ?

JKB

--
Le cerveau, c'est un véritable scandale écologique. Il représente 2% de notre
masse corporelle, mais disperse à lui seul 25% de l'énergie que nous
consommons tous les jours.



Avatar
Luc.Habert.00__arjf
ROBERT LEFEVRE :

Je l'ai déjà fait (page de man de sane) mais le problème vient
d'ailleurs je pense. Au redémarrage, mon scanner est maintenant sur
/dev/sg4 et bien sûr il ne fonctionne pas. C'est pourquoi je pense à
écrire une règle udev.


OK, c'est un problème différent. Il y a des chances que tu aies un
/etc/udev/rules.d/*libsane.rules, qui doit contenir une règle qui matche ton
scanner, puisque quelque chose t'a donné les droits de lecture et écriture
dessus. Je pense qu'il suffirait d'à ajouter « ,SYMLINK+="scanner" » au bout
de la ligne en question. Enfin, il serait plus propre de créer un autre
fichier de règle pour ça, en fait.

Avatar
ROBERT LEFEVRE
Bonjour,
J'essaie d'installer un scanner scsi canon (canoscan 300) sue mon
linux (Debian Etch).
1) La commande "sane-find-scanner" me le trouve bien :
found SCSI scanner "CANON IX-03035B 1.02" at /dev/sg5
# Your SCSI scanner was detected. It may or may not be supported by
SANE. Try
# scanimage -L and read the backend's manpage.
2) Par contre, la commande "scanimage -L" me renvoie:

device `v4l:/dev/video0' is a Noname BT878 video (Pinnacle PCTV Stud
virtual device
3) Si je lance xsane, je me retrouve bien à scanner avec... ma carte
Pinnacle studio TV.
Je sais qu'on peut écrire des règles udev, pour qu'à un périphérique
donné ne soit pas attribué un fichier /dev/sg* qui correspond à un
autre, mais je ne sais pas comment faire. J'ai été regarder dans
/etc/udev et j'ai peur de casser quelque chose.
Un coup de main svp, merci!


Bonjour,
Je vais peut-être persévérer dans l'erreur, mais je viens de faire une
réponse dans le fil SOS du 01/02.
Cette réponse est peut-être valide pour ce problème là aussi.

Sans garantie.

Cordialement
M.D.
Bonjour,

Je vais essayer d'écrire une règle udev pour mon scanner, c'est ce que
je soupçonne depuis le début, et je la mettrai en sauvegarde.
Merci encore à tous, A+